Software solves problems for people. Otherwise, people will not use WordPress or any other software product. It must help them achieve a goal faster and easier compared to other solutions. It’s ultimately the value that certain code provides that makes it useful. Definitely not the volume – lines of code, commits, contributors, etc. Do more engineering and write less code. When I say “code” I mean production code. Throwing code all the time is like sketching. Do it whenever you have an idea. Test it and watch it fail. Learn from it. Or throw in code that breaks your production code. Learn from that experience! Learning comes from mistakes, not success.

